That awful translucent menu bar in Leopard is now optional. Leaked screenshots of 10.5.2 show the option to turn on/off that menu bar “feature,” which, along with Stacks’ erratic behavior, annoyed me more than anything else in Leopard.

Speaking of Stacks, Apple made it so that the feature works like pre-Leopard folder-in-the-dock worked: list view has returned. Sounds like 10.5.2 is finally what 10.5.0 should have been.
